少儿编程教育是学什么专业
-
少儿编程教育是一门涉及计算机编程和教育学的综合学科。学习少儿编程教育需要掌握计算机编程的基础知识和技能,同时也需要了解儿童的认知特点和教育心理学的基本理论。
首先,学习少儿编程教育需要具备计算机编程的基础知识和技能。这包括掌握编程语言的基本语法、数据结构与算法、软件开发工具等。常见的编程语言包括Python、Java、Scratch等,学习者需要根据具体需求选择适合的编程语言进行学习。
其次,学习少儿编程教育还需要了解儿童的认知特点和教育心理学的基本理论。儿童的认知发展具有一定的规律和特点,了解这些特点有助于设计适合儿童的编程教育内容和教学方法。此外,教育心理学的基本理论也能够帮助教师更好地理解儿童的学习过程和心理需求,从而更好地引导和促进他们的学习。
总结起来,学习少儿编程教育需要掌握计算机编程的基础知识和技能,同时也需要了解儿童的认知特点和教育心理学的基本理论。这是一门综合性的学科,需要不断学习和实践,以提升自己在教学实践中的能力和水平。
1年前 -
少儿编程教育是一门跨学科的专业,涉及到计算机科学、教育学和心理学等领域。以下是与少儿编程教育相关的一些专业:
-
计算机科学:这是少儿编程教育最核心的专业领域之一。学习计算机科学可以让教师掌握编程语言、数据结构、算法和软件开发等知识,为他们提供教授编程技能的基础。
-
教育学:教育学是研究教育原理和教学方法的学科,对于少儿编程教育来说,教育学的知识可以帮助教师了解儿童的认知发展阶段、学习特点和学习需求,从而设计和实施适合他们的教学方案。
-
心理学:心理学是研究人类心理活动和行为的学科,对于少儿编程教育来说,了解儿童的心理特点和认知发展规律是非常重要的。教师需要了解如何激发儿童的学习兴趣、培养他们的自信心,并解决可能出现的学习障碍。
-
现代教育技术:现代教育技术是运用计算机和互联网等技术手段改进教学和学习过程的学科。在少儿编程教育中,教师需要熟悉如何利用教育软件、编程工具和在线学习平台等技术工具来进行教学和辅助学习。
-
创意设计:创意设计是培养学生创造力和创新思维的学科。在少儿编程教育中,教师可以运用创意设计的方法来设计有趣、富有挑战性的编程项目,激发学生的学习兴趣和创造力。
总结起来,少儿编程教育涉及到计算机科学、教育学、心理学、现代教育技术和创意设计等多个专业领域。学习这些专业可以帮助教师获得编程技能和教育教学的专业知识,从而更好地开展少儿编程教育工作。
1年前 -
-
少儿编程教育是一门跨学科的教育专业,涉及到计算机科学、教育学和心理学等多个领域。学习少儿编程教育需要掌握一系列的知识和技能,包括计算机编程、教育教学理论、儿童心理学等方面的内容。
下面将从方法、操作流程等方面讲解学习少儿编程教育的专业知识和技能。
一、学习计算机编程
学习少儿编程教育的第一步是掌握计算机编程的基础知识和技能。这包括学习编程语言(如Python、Scratch等)、掌握算法和数据结构等。学习计算机编程可以通过自学、参加编程培训班或者选择相关专业进行系统学习。二、学习教育教学理论
在学习少儿编程教育时,了解教育教学理论是非常重要的。这包括学习教育心理学、教育学、教育技术学等方面的知识。学习教育教学理论可以帮助你更好地理解儿童的学习特点和需求,设计和实施适合儿童的编程教育课程。三、了解儿童心理学
学习少儿编程教育还需要了解儿童心理学,了解儿童的认知发展、情感发展和行为发展等方面的知识。这可以帮助你更好地理解儿童的学习方式和需求,设计和实施针对儿童的编程教育课程。四、参加实践活动
学习少儿编程教育不仅需要理论知识,还需要通过实践活动来提升实际操作能力。可以参加一些编程教育实践活动,比如组织编程工作坊、开展编程比赛等。通过实践活动,可以锻炼自己的教学能力和创新能力。五、继续学习和提升
学习少儿编程教育是一个不断学习和提升的过程。随着科技的不断发展和教育需求的变化,需要不断学习新的知识和技能。可以参加相关的培训课程、研讨会和研究活动,与其他从事少儿编程教育的专业人士交流和分享经验。总结起来,学习少儿编程教育需要掌握计算机编程、教育教学理论和儿童心理学等方面的知识和技能。通过学习和实践,不断提升自己的能力和水平,为儿童提供优质的编程教育。
1年前